						 Mean
						 
						1. Selfish; acting without consideration of others. It was mean to steal his son's money.

 3. Penurious; miserly; stingy. He is so mean, he never buys gifts for his children.
 4. Accomplished with great skill; deft; hard to compete with. He plays a mean game of tennis.
 5. To intend. I didn't mean to injure her.
 6. To intend  (something) for a given purpose or fate. I meant to give this desk to my daughter.
 7. To result in; to bring about. Touching that wire will mean certain death.
 8. To be important to. My home means a lot to me.
 9. To convey an idea, reason or purpose. What do you mean by that?
